Arnhem world's most Bitcoin friendly city located in Netherlands, you can buy everything with bitcoin in it.
Arnhem Bitcoinstad" ('Bitcoin City') as they call it, came into existence when three Bitcoin enthusiasts decided they wanted to be able to spend bitcoins in their own town. They went on a mission to convince local bars and restaurant owners to accept bitcoin payments. At the opening at May 28th 2014, 15 places accepted bitcoins. Since then, more and more shop owners joined them so you can buy a greater diversity of products and pay with Bitcoin in Arnhem.

Maybe some already know it but in northern Switzerland there is small town its name is Zug which has begun to accept payments in bitcoin for certain public services from May 2016 as a part of a pilot crypto project. The municipality of Zug accepts the amount of 200 francs worth in equivalent of bitcoin.
